OCF Yield % is calculated as Cash Flow from Operations divided by Market Capitalization. It is a financial solvency ratio that compares the operating cash flow a company is expected to earn against its market value.

As of today, Institut IGH DD's Trailing 12-Month Cash Flow from Operations is €0.33 Mil, and Market Cap is €17.99 Mil. Therefore, Institut IGH DD's OCF Yield % for today is 1.85%.

Institut IGH DD OCF Yield % Explanation

Similar to Earnings Yield %, OCF Yield % is financial solvency ratio. A lower ratio suggests a less attractive investment, indicating that investors might not receive substantial returns in proportion to their investment. Conversely, a high operating cash flow yield signals that a company generates sufficient cash to comfortably meet its debts, obligations, and dividend payments, making it a promising investment choice.

Institut IGH DD Business Description

Address Janka Rakuse 1, Zagreb, HRV, 10000
Institut IGH DD is a consulting company for engineering services in the field of construction in Croatia and the region, providing support to infrastructure and investment projects and solutions in the field of construction in Croatia and international markets. Its services are management of holding companies, architectural and engineering activities, technical consulting, improvement of regulations in the field of construction, improvement of development programs and construction technologies, and protection, preservation, and improvement of space. Its segments include Department of Design, the Department of Professional Supervision and Project Management generate maximum revenue, Department of Materials and Structures, Branches, and Management and Support Services.
